(a) Monitoring an estimation of the a~aount <br />of flow being discharged. <br /> <br /> (b) The maximum allowable volume of suspended <br />solids being discharged shall not exceed 50 mg/liter. <br /> <br /> (c) The pH values of the discharge shall be <br />a minimum of 6 and shall not exceed a maximum of 8.5. <br /> <br /> (d) In addition, the operator shall monitor <br />on a six month basis the following heavy metals: total <br />copper, total zinc, total nickel, aluminum, hexavalent <br />chromium, total iron, arsenic, total lead, magnesiura, mercury, <br />barium, selenium, and vanadium contents in the settlement <br />pond in order to insure compliance with Virginia State Water <br />Control Board regulations. <br /> <br /> (7) The final design of the pier belt shall <br />incorporate decking or an equivalent measure to prevent coat <br />from spilling into the water and to facilitate cleaning of <br />coal spillage. <br /> <br /> (8) Wind breakers shall be installed on the pier <br />belt and ship loader to maintain the opacity limit set by <br />the.Virginia State Air Pollution Board Permit. <br /> <br /> (9) The base for the coal storage pile shall be <br />composed of layers, from the bottom up, of impervious clay, <br />oyster shells, limestone, and a low sulfer coal or some other <br />base equivalent to the above. <br /> <br />(10) Dust sprays shall be installed for the reclaim <br /> <br />hoppers. <br /> <br /> (11) Dust from the shi~ loader vacuum dust collector <br />shall either be put back with the loaded coal in the Dhip <br />hold or transferred to a coal holding bunker on board ship <br />for use by the ship. Either method shall be accomplished <br />without exceeding opacity limits required by the Virginia <br />State Air Pollution Control Board Permit. <br /> <br /> (12) The thawing shed shall be electrically heated <br />and shall not emit dust or fumes. <br /> <br /> (13) There shall be installed, operated and maintained <br />an air quality monitoring system to monitor the dispersion of <br />coal dust along the rail lines within the City of Portsmouth <br />from the City limits to the site. The air quality along the <br />rail lines shall not exceed those standards established by the <br />State Air Pollution Control Board. <br /> <br /> (14) The movement and control of rail traffic <br />through the City in a manner acceptable to the City so as to <br />minimize interference with vehicular traffic on City streets. <br /> <br /> (15) An agreement between the operators and <br />the servicing railroads which will prohibit tall traffic <br /> <br /> <br />
